| Term | Definition |
| preamble | The introduction to the Constitution. |
| popular sovereignty | The idea that the people rule. |
| separation of powers | Idea that the government should be split up. |
| elastic clause | This give congress the power to make laws "necessary and proper." |
| federalism | Government is divided into delegated, reserved, and concurrent. |
| concurrent powers | Powers shared by national and state government. |
| delegated powers | Powers belonging to national government. |
| reserved powers | Powers belonging to state government. |
| checks and balances | It helps ensure that each branch doesn't get too powerful. |
